Turkish HÜRJET aircraft Afterburner Test with Dual Pilots

HÜRJET Jet Evolution and Light Attack Aircraft, developed by Turkish Aerospace Industries (TUSAŞ) , successfully completed afterburner and go-around tests. On the other hand, during the tests, it was seen that there were two pilots on HÜRJET at the same time for the first time.
In the statement made by TAI on the subject, it was emphasized that HÜRJET continues its double cockpit, high power performance tests.
Afterburner is known as a special system found on the jet engines of warplanes. This system is used to instantly increase aircraft speed and perform fast maneuvers. Although it increases fuel consumption, afterburner is defined as a critical component to meet the sudden speed needs of warplanes and provide maneuverability.
It is envisaged that HÜRJET, which continues its high power performance tests, will begin comprehensive maneuver tests prepared according to various scenarios after the completion of these tests. HÜRJET test pilots play an active role in calibrating HÜRJET so that it can be used in jet training missions.
Configurations planned to be worked on; Transition to Combat Readiness Training, Light Attack (Close Air Support), Opposing Force Task in Training, Air Patrol (Armed and Unarmed), Acrobatic Demonstration Aircraft, Aircraft Carrier Compatible Aircraft.
Within the scope of the project, it is planned to produce two prototype flyable aircraft and one static and one fatigue test aircraft to be used in test activities.
